Drug order= 0.25mg/kg
Weight 50kg
Available= 25mg(5mg/ml)
1. Client dose:
0.25mg/kg
0.25*50
12.5mg.
2. How much ml?
Available= 1ml=5mg
0.5ml=2.5mg
2ml=10mg
2.5ml=12.5mg
Answer= 2.5ml
3. Per minute:
2.5 ml over 2 minutes
1.25ml in 1 minute.
So option a is correct.
